    What is Dr. Harris Nagler's specialty?

    Dr. Nagler is a Urologist near Manhasset, NY. A urologist is a healthcare professional with specialization in managing both benign and malignant medical and surgical disorders of the genitourinary system and adrenal glands. They possess extensive knowledge and skills in endoscopic, percutaneous, and open surgical techniques for addressing congenital and acquired conditions of the urinary and reproductive systems, as well as their associated structures.     Is this Dr. Harris Nagler aff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Nagler is affiliated with Lenox Hill Hospital, North Shore University Hospital, Long Island Jewish Medical Center which are a Castle Connolly Top Hospitals.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
